Position Summary
Young Harris College invites applications for a full-time, tenure-track Assistant Professor of Law, beginning August 1, 2026. We seek a dynamic teacher‑scholar with the ability to teach a range of foundational and upper‑level law courses. The ideal candidate must be able to teach Business Law, Estate Planning, and Employment Law. The ability to also teach Introduction to the American Legal System and Constitutional Law is preferred.
Additionally, the new hire will be instrumental in shaping the future of Young Harris’s legal studies programs.
Candidates must hold a J.D. from an ABA‑accredited law school or an equivalent degree (such as a Ph.D.) in a related field. Candidates should have a passion for teaching, a record of or potential for scholarly distinction, and a commitment to service.
Applicants should include a cover letter, curriculum vitae, and a list of at least three references. Official transcripts are required of the chosen hire prior to beginning employment.
